66 The fix is to, when using prefetch, take the query and put it into a subquery
67 joined to the tables we're prefetching from. This might result in the same
68 table being joined once in the main subquery and once in the main query. This
69 may actually resolve other, unknown edgecase bugs. It is also the right way
70 to do prefetching. Optimizations can come later.
